Understanding Coconut Aminos and Their Composition
To determine proper storage, it’s essential to first understand what coconut aminos are made of and how they differ from traditional soy sauce.
The Making of Coconut Aminos
Coconut aminos are crafted from the fermented sap of the coconut palm. This sap is harvested, fermented, and then blended with sea salt. The fermentation process naturally reduces the sugar content and develops a savory, umami flavor profile that mimics soy sauce. However, unlike soy sauce, coconut aminos are soy-free, gluten-free, and typically lower in sodium.
Nutritional Profile and Differences from Soy Sauce
Coconut aminos boasts a unique nutritional profile. It contains amino acids, which are the building blocks of protein, though in relatively small amounts. The primary appeal lies in its lower sodium content and absence of common allergens like soy and gluten. Soy sauce, on the other hand, is made from fermented soybeans and wheat, making it unsuitable for those with sensitivities to these ingredients.

Factors Influencing the Need for Refrigeration of Coconut Aminos
Several factors determine whether your coconut aminos bottle needs to be stored in the refrigerator after opening.
Manufacturer’s Recommendations
The most reliable source of information regarding storage is always the manufacturer’s label. Different brands may use different production methods and preservatives, leading to varying storage recommendations. Always read the label carefully to see if the manufacturer specifies refrigeration after opening.
Preservatives Used (or Not Used)
Some manufacturers add preservatives to their coconut aminos to extend shelf life and reduce the risk of spoilage. If a product contains preservatives, it may be less susceptible to spoilage at room temperature. However, many brands pride themselves on using natural ingredients and avoiding artificial preservatives. In such cases, refrigeration becomes more critical.
Storage Temperature and Humidity
The ambient temperature and humidity of your storage environment also play a significant role. If you live in a hot or humid climate, even coconut aminos that might not require refrigeration under normal circumstances could benefit from being stored in the fridge. High temperatures accelerate microbial growth, increasing the risk of spoilage.
Frequency of Use
How often you use your coconut aminos can also influence the need for refrigeration. If you use it frequently, the bottle will be opened and closed more often, exposing the contents to air and potential contaminants. Frequent opening and closing can increase the risk of spoilage, making refrigeration a prudent choice.

Understanding Shelf Life: Opened vs. Unopened Bottles
The shelf life of coconut aminos differs considerably between unopened and opened bottles.
Unopened Bottles: Typically Shelf-Stable
Unopened bottles of coconut aminos are generally shelf-stable and can be stored in a cool, dark place, such as a pantry, until the expiration date. The airtight seal and the presence of preservatives (if any) help to prevent spoilage.
Opened Bottles: Shorter Shelf Life, Refrigeration Often Recommended
Once opened, the shelf life of coconut aminos is significantly reduced. The contents are exposed to air and potential contaminants, increasing the risk of spoilage. Refrigeration is often recommended to extend the shelf life of opened bottles, typically for several months.
Different Brands, Different Recommendations
Storage instructions can vary between brands, highlighting the importance of reading the product label.
Comparing Popular Brands: Storage Guidelines
Some brands may explicitly state “Refrigerate After Opening,” while others may offer less specific guidance. Brands emphasizing natural ingredients and no preservatives are more likely to recommend refrigeration. Pay close attention to the instructions provided by the manufacturer.
Why Variations Exist: Ingredients and Processing Methods
Variations in storage recommendations can be attributed to differences in ingredients and processing methods. Some manufacturers may use pasteurization or other techniques to extend shelf life, while others may rely solely on natural fermentation and sea salt for preservation. The presence or absence of preservatives also plays a key role.

What happens if I don’t refrigerate coconut aminos after opening?
If you choose not to refrigerate coconut aminos after opening, it’s possible that the product’s flavor and color will degrade more quickly. While it might not immediately become unsafe to consume, you may notice a change in taste, a darkening in color, or a slight fermentation odor. This degradation is due to the natural sugars and amino acids reacting with air and potential microbial activity.
While the high salt content provides some protection, it isn’t a guarantee against spoilage, especially over an extended period. The rate of degradation will depend on factors like the ambient temperature, humidity, and the specific formulation of the coconut aminos product. Therefore, refrigeration is strongly advised to preserve the quality and extend the shelf life.

How can I tell if my coconut aminos have gone bad?
Several indicators can signal that your coconut aminos have gone bad. Look for changes in appearance, such as cloudiness, separation, or the presence of mold. Similarly, observe for changes in smell. A sour, fermented, or generally “off” odor is a strong indication of spoilage.
Finally, any significant change in taste, particularly a sour or unpleasant flavor that differs from its usual savory-sweet profile, suggests the product should be discarded. Trust your senses – if anything seems amiss, it’s best to err on the side of caution and dispose of the coconut aminos to avoid any potential foodborne illness.
